摘要
Inquiring traffic information is an important issue in vehicular ad hoc networks. This paper proposes an aggregating data dissemination and discovery algorithm in vehicular ad hoc networks. In general, the user obtains the detailed data of the small area, or only the summary data from the large area. This algorithm can offer various degrees of data aggregation in accordance with different inquiry ranges. The traffic information is aggregated and exchanged between the roadside units. The aggregated data of region are delivered along dissemination trajectories and kept in the periphery of region. The proposed algorithm disseminates the aggregated data in the high level cell effectively. The user can obtain the aggregated data from the periphery of inquiry area immediately. The simulation results show that our algorithm can decrease the inquiry cost and increase the efficiency of data aggregation. Additionally, the users can obtain the data quickly, when they only need the summary data.
